Slackness among public and officials in taking steps to contain COVID has led to increase - 3Ts to be implemented

Posted on: 29/Mar/2021 9:27:39 AM
In Chennai and in TN the number of Coronavirus cases are increasing slowly now!!

In this scenario, on Sunday, the health secretary of TN Mr. J. Radhakrishnan cautioned against laxity or slackness among public and officials in taking measures to control the spread of Covid-19 pandemic. He was busy in allocating 300 beds for Covid-19 patients at RGGGH in Chennai.

He spoke about how there has been some laxity among some officials and he asked not to throw away the gains that were achieved in the past due to effective control measures. The 3 T�s Test track and treat strategy are very important for controlling the spread of the Coronavirus infection. Mr. Radhakrishnan threw light on how the officials have been strictly asked to implement these 3 T�s now. It must be noted that 9 districts in TN had TRP higher than2% and now just 5 districts have TRP of more than 3%. Point is that for every person who has been tested positive for Covid-19 infection field workers have been asked to test atleast 30 of their contacts.

IIT-Madras has developed ITIHAS software and it is now said that this software is also used to proactively identify the potential hotspots. Information is that more cases were reported in clusters in the apartment complexes in this second surge of cases. The health secretary later threw light on how the public must wear facemasks and maintain social distancing compulsorily. Working from home option must be considered now. People who are eligible for Covid vaccination must get vaccinated at the earliest to avoid or to prevent spreading of the infection.

It is important to mention here that the TN government would not create panic amongst the public by taking sudden decisions about imposing another lockdown now. Truth is that the situation now is much better with the availability of adequate health infrastructure and vaccines etc.
